The light should be as close as you can get it without burning the plants....its fairly simple, but for a new grower it can be a bit hit and miss. The old test is to put your hand under the light and feel the temperature....If its too warm, raise the light a little, if its cool lower the light to get the maximum advantage. Just remember your plants are in the light for 18 to 24 hours a day. If the light is even a little bit uncomfortable for you after 1 minute, your plants don't stand a chance. all strains are different you cant use a chart for anything in growing unless youve compilated one for a certian growing environment and a certian strain over time and only then do you know exactly what they need. to tell what the plant likes lower the light until the leaves are reaching up tward the light like a V. or until the leaves start to cup inward and get hard ridges on the leaves....then back the light off until they stop cupping. = thats the proper light heigth. try and keep it at that level through flowering until the last few weeks- then some plants get hardened to the light and can take it even lower.... goodluck!
